5-2 Saving measured values in a file
Data sampled with the trend monitor can be exported and imported as a CSV format file.
Outputting the results of sampling as a file
Sampled measured values can be saved as a CSV format file.
A file is prepared each time the trigger condition is met.
1
Check the checkbox for the save destination.
2
Set the save condition.
Exporting the results of sampling
Sampled measured values can be exported as a CSV format file.
Item
Setting item
Range
Description
File settings
Logging mode
Single
When the trigger end condition is met, sampling stops.
Continuous
Sampling does not stop until you press the End icon. Each
time the trigger start condition is met, a new file is prepared
and saved.
Save in
This is the folder to save the files in.
File prefix
This is the prefix for the name of the file saved.
Samples per file
100 to 10000000
This is the number of samples saved in one file. If more
samples than this set number are taken, a new file is
prepared.
Max sampling
time
0:0:0 to 24:59:59
This indicates the upper limit on the interval for saving a file.
